Variation of magnetic energy in oriented ultra-thin ferromagnetic films

P. Samarasekara

Abstract


The angle dependence of magnetic energy of ultra-thin films with N=1 to 5 layers has been investigated. The effect of stress and the demagnetization factor on the classical Heisenberg Hamiltonian has been taken into account in addition to other magnetic factors. Films of sc(001) and bcc(001) ferromagnetic indicate preferred in plane and perpendicular orienta- tions for N3 and N4, respectively. Easy and hard directions of all sc(001), bcc(001) and fcc(001) films with five layers are = 7.2°and = 114°respectively. According to our simu- lation, ultra-thin films with one or two layers can be easily oriented in =279°direction.
